Celo is an Ethereum Layer-2 network built to broaden access to blockchain technology. Operating as a smart contract platform within the broader Optimism Superchain ecosystem, it emphasizes scalability, low transaction fees, and a user-friendly experience aimed at supporting applications that serve large, global user bases. The native CELO token functions as the network's utility and governance asset, used for staking, securing the chain through a proof-of-stake consensus mechanism, and participating in on-chain governance decisions. Celo is designed to support decentralized applications, payments, and financial services, particularly in mobile-first contexts. The project originated in the United States and counts several prominent venture firms among its backers, including Andreessen Horowitz (a16z), Coinbase Ventures, and DWF Labs. It also launched via the CoinList Launchpad and maintains ties to Outlier Ventures. Together, these associations reflect Celo's positioning as an accessible, developer-oriented Layer-2 within the Ethereum ecosystem.
